I think peer-to-peer renting and Zilok could be a great example to show positive and community-driven initiatives during these tough economic times.
The economic crisis has already had a very direct impact on our lives, and people are starting to look for new ways to save or make money. Zilok provides both.
Zilok’s mission is to support and promote peer-to-peer renting as a new, sustainable and community-driven way of consuming. The idea is that there is so much stuff that we have and barely use. So much stuff gathering dust in your closet while a neighbor is going to have to buy the same thing new. Zilok is the place where you can connect with this neighbor and rent to him or her your drill, your stroller, your camping gear, your lawnmower, your digital camera, your pressure washer, your truck, just about anything.
You’ll make some extra money in the process. He or she will save money. And the environment is winning too, because useless packaging, transportation and natural resources won’t have to be wasted while perpetuating the accumulation of unused goods in our households.
